English: This is a photograph of the Maricopa Stake Tabernacle of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ints published in the Deseret News newspaper, alongside a short article about the Mormons in Mesa, Arizona. This building was constructed in 1895-96 and razed in 1967. It was located at the corner of 1st Avenue and Morris St., Mesa, Arizona.
